Title: Pribadi Kardono: Innovator in Endoscope Drying Technology
Introduction
Pribadi Kardono is a notable inventor based in Monroeville, PA (US). He has made significant contributions to the field of medical technology, particularly in the development of systems for drying endoscopes. With a total of 10 patents to his name, Kardono's work is instrumental in enhancing the efficiency and safety of medical procedures involving endoscopes.
Latest Patents
Kardono's latest patents include a "Forced-air drying cabinet, system, and computer program product for drying endoscopes." This invention describes a forced-air drying cabinet that features a local control device, an inner area accessible by a door, a signal receiving device, and a drying manifold with a compressor. The system is designed to initiate a drying process by creating airflow through the endoscope, ensuring effective drying based on a determined protocol.
Another significant patent is the "System, method, and computer program product for tracking endoscopes in a forced-air drying cabinet." This invention outlines a method for tracking endoscopes using a signal emitting member. It includes determining a drying protocol based on the endoscope's identifier and initiating a drying process when the endoscope is connected to the airflow output.
